How I work with product teams.
Let's work togetherStep 1
I start with the business goal, the current product, and where users get stuck. That usually means stakeholder conversations, reviewing analytics or support feedback, and mapping the existing flows before anything gets redesigned.
Step 2
I turn priorities into clear flows, wireframes, and UI. When a decision is risky, I prototype it and walk through it with the team so we can fix issues before development starts.
Step 3
I document the work for engineering, stay involved through build and QA, and help prioritize what to fix after launch based on real usage, not assumptions.

Figma design systems that keep product teams aligned and shipping fast.
Talk about your systemI build and maintain Figma design systems that scale with the product, not against it. Whether standing up a new library or tightening an existing one, I focus on what teams need to design and ship with confidence.
On every project, the system lives inside the work. New screens are built from shared components. Patterns get documented as they prove out. Engineers reference the same source of truth through Figma dev mode and component specs. The result is fewer one off decisions, faster iteration, and a product that feels cohesive from homepage to checkout.
Color, type, spacing, and grid variables organized in Figma so every screen starts from the same base. Teams stop guessing and start composing.
Reusable UI built with auto layout, component properties, and states. Buttons, inputs, cards, and navigation ready to assemble without rebuilding from scratch.
Page layouts and flows documented in Figma so new features inherit structure. PLP, PDP, checkout, and dashboard patterns stay consistent as the product grows.
Specs, dev mode, and Storybook alignment so design and engineering stay in sync through build. The system is useful in meetings, in Figma, and in code.
